欢迎光临
我们一直在努力
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告

服务器数量与扩展性解析

服务器数量与扩展性解析
服务器数量与扩展性解析

一、引言

随着信息技术的飞速发展,服务器作为网络应用的核心设备,其数量与扩展性已成为企业、组织乃至个人在构建或扩展网络系统时必须面对的关键问题。

服务器数量的增减直接影响着网络系统的性能、稳定性和运营成本,而扩展性则决定了系统在面对增长的业务需求时能否灵活应对。

本文将对服务器数量与扩展性进行小哥解析,探讨二者之间的关系及其在实际应用中的重要性。

二、服务器数量对网络系统的影响

1. 性能表现

服务器数量对网络系统的性能表现具有直接影响。

在负载均衡的情况下,增加服务器数量可以显著提高网络系统的处理能力和响应速度,从而提升用户体验。

过多或过少的服务器可能导致资源分配不均,影响整体性能。

2. 稳定性

服务器数量与网络的稳定性密切相关。

在高峰访问时段,足够的服务器数量可以分担网络负载,避免因过载而导致的网络瘫痪。

相反,服务器数量不足可能导致网络拥堵,降低网络稳定性。

3. 运营成本

服务器数量也直接影响着运营成本。

更多的服务器意味着更高的硬件、软件和维护成本。

因此,合理设置服务器数量需要在性能、稳定性和成本之间取得平衡。

三、扩展性的重要性及其与服务器数量的关系

1. 扩展性的定义

扩展性是指网络系统在面对增长的业务需求时,能够灵活地增加或减少资源以满足需求的变化,同时保证系统性能和服务质量。

2. 扩展性与服务器数量的关系

扩展性与服务器数量紧密相关。

在初始阶段,可能只需要少量的服务器就能满足业务需求。

但随着业务的增长,需要增加服务器数量以满足日益增长的需求。

此时,如果系统具有良好的扩展性,就能轻松地增加服务器数量,提高系统性能。

因此,扩展性是决定在业务增长过程中如何有效地增加服务器数量的关键因素。

四、如何实现系统的扩展性

1. 架构设计

要实现系统的扩展性,首先需要在架构设计阶段进行充分考虑。

采用微服务、容器化等架构技术可以使系统更易于扩展。

这些技术有助于实现系统的松耦合和高内聚,使得在业务增长时能够灵活地增加或减少服务实例。

2. 负载均衡与自动扩展

通过实施负载均衡和自动扩展策略,可以在业务增长时自动增加服务器数量。

负载均衡可以确保请求在多个服务器之间均匀分布,从而提高系统整体性能。

而自动扩展则可以根据业务需求和系统性能指标自动调整服务器数量。

3. 监控与日志分析

实施有效的监控和日志分析是实现系统扩展性的关键。

通过监控系统的性能指标和日志数据,可以了解系统的实时状态和需求。

这有助于及时发现性能瓶颈,并预测未来的业务需求,从而制定合适的扩展策略。

五、案例分析

以某电商网站为例,随着业务规模的扩大,其需要处理更多的用户请求和交易数据。

为了保持系统的稳定性和性能,该网站逐渐增加了服务器数量,并实施了负载均衡和自动扩展策略。

同时,通过监控和日志分析,该网站能够及时发现性能瓶颈并预测未来的业务需求,从而制定合适的扩展策略。

这些措施使得该网站在面对业务增长时能够保持高性能和高质量的服务。

六、结论

服务器数量与扩展性是网络系统设计中的关键因素。

合理设置服务器数量并在架构设计中考虑扩展性,是实现高性能、稳定且成本效益高的网络系统的关键。

通过实施负载均衡、自动扩展、监控和日志分析等技术,可以提高系统的扩展性,从而应对业务需求的增长。

高防国内云服务器,国内高防物理机独立服务器就找虎跃云-www.huyuekj.com

赞(0)
未经允许不得转载:优乐评测网 » 服务器数量与扩展性解析

优乐评测网 找服务器 更专业 更方便 更快捷!

专注IDC行业资源共享发布,给大家带来方便快捷的资源查找平台!

联系我们